Fig. 3 shows the light-collecting sheet 12 in a schematic sectional view. The light-collecting film 12 consists of a plastic, for example of polycarbonate or PVC, in which a fluorescent dye is incorporated. In Fig. 3 For example, a dye particle 13 is shown in high magnification. When irradiated with light, the dye particle 13 is excited to fluoresce and radiates in all directions fluorescent light having a larger wavelength than the incident light. The incident light rays are in Fig. 3 designated by the reference numeral 14, the rays of the fluorescent light by the reference numerals 15 and 16.

Since the light-collecting sheet 12 has a greater refractive index than the air, at angles above the critical angle of total reflection, reflection occurs at the boundary surface. It should be noted that the angle is measured in each case to the perpendicular of the surface. That is, the fluorescent rays 15 do not leave the light-collecting sheet 12, but are alternately reflected on the opposite major surfaces until they reach one of the end faces of the light-gathering sheet 12 connecting the two main surfaces. Since the fluorescent rays 15 impinge on the end surface at a relatively small angle, they exit the light-collecting film 12 through the end surface. When passing through the end face, the fluorescent rays 15 are refracted according to the refractive index ratio between the light-collecting sheet 12 and the surrounding air.

This means that the light beams 14 impinging on the skin surfaces of the light-collecting film 12 produce fluorescence beams 15 and 16 which leave the light-collecting film 12 partly over their end faces and partly over their main surfaces. Since the end faces have a significantly smaller surface area than the main surfaces, the light concentrates in the region of the end faces and leads there to an increased brightness.

An associated schematic sectional view is in Fig. 5 shown. In contrast to the first embodiment of the card 1, this embodiment not according to the invention has no graphic element 6 with particularly bright contours. Instead, the entire area of the graphic element 6 is uniformly illuminated.

The main surfaces of the light-collecting sheet 12 are covered with the transparent cover sheets 8 and 9. The light-collecting film 12 is clearly formed and has a three-dimensional surface structure 17 in the region of the graphic element 6. The surface structure 17 is in the enlarged section of Fig. 5 shown and has a plurality of laterally successive elevations and depressions, which may be formed, for example, wave-shaped. The surface structure 17 reduces the proportion of the fluorescence beams 15 reflected at the interface of the light-collecting film 12 and increases the proportion of the fluorescence beams 16 passing through the interface. As a result, the entire area of the surface structure 17 appears brighter than the adjacent areas of the light-collecting surface 12 having a smooth surface. The contour of the graphic element 6 has no or only slightly increased brightness relative to its inner region.

Fig. 7 shows a fourth embodiment of the card 1 in a schematic plan view. An associated schematic sectional view is in Fig. 8 shown. The card body 2 has an opaque core film 7 with a plurality of recesses 11 for each graphical element 6. Furthermore, the card body 2 has a light-collecting foil 12 which adjoins the main surface of the core foil 7 with its main surface and thus represents a further layer of the card body 2 in addition to the core foil 7. In this case, the light-collecting film 12 extends into the recesses 11 of the core film 7 and fills these completely. The main surfaces of the card body 2 are through each one transparent cover sheet 8 or 9 formed, that is, both the core sheet 7 and the light-collecting sheet 12 are covered by a cover sheet 8 and 9 respectively.

In this case, the contours of the graphic elements 6 appear very bright, since light is irradiated into the light-collecting sheet 12 over an entire main surface of the card body 2 and the fluorescent light only escapes over the end faces of the light-collecting sheet 12 and over the edges of the recesses 11 in the core sheet 7 can. The brightness is greater, the smaller the area of the recesses 11 in the core film 7 is.
